This week, we speak to Kate Davidson Hudson – previously Accessories director at ELLE US & Harpers Bazaar US. She is now the Co-Founder & CEO of Editorialist.com – the only online destination that is exclusive to the accessories market. Check out which facialist she swears by, her minimalist make up style and why she uses Macadamia nut oil.

 

-Beauty products I swear by: 

I love Sonya Dakar’s Hydrasoft lotion; it’s chock full of pro-vitamins and goes on light-as-air so your skin doesn’t feel weighed down or greasy. I wear it at night and my skin feels fully replenished and hydrated by the morning. I’m also very fair so when I’m running around during the day sunscreen is a non-negotiable. I love Chanel Précision UV Essentiel; it is SPF 50 and feels weightless, and silky on your skin.

 

-What’s in my make up bag: 

I’m a bit of a Minimalist when it comes to everyday makeup. I never leave home without my Laura Mercier tinted moisturizer, Chanel mascara, and Mac Pretty Please lipstick.

-Perfect detox juice mix:

I generally eat very healthy and I’m allergic to most fruits so I am limited in options when it comes to the classic ‘detox’ juices. But, one of my guilty pleasures is a banana vanilla concoction of: 1/2 a banana, 1 scoop of French vanilla protein powder, ice, and 1 packet of Stevia. It’s simple and so delicious; you feel like you’re treating yourself to a dessert.

-Fitness routine:

I do light cardio 4-5 times per week along with 1 Pilates session per week. With my schedule, carving out time to get to the gym is challenging so 20-30 minutes on the elliptical is enough to keep me feeling energized and focused. I try to work at least 1 Pilates session in per week to keep me feeling lean and toned.

-Hair Miracle

Macadamia nut oil; I run a dime-sized portion through my hair when I step out of the shower and it works wonders in keeping my hair strong and preventing any breakage.
